Cheapest Available Foothill Green Apartments for Rent

 

The cheapest available apartment rental in the Foothill Green area of Denver, CO is a 1 Bed unit found at Columbine West Apartments priced from $1,494. Skyecrest has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$1,559. Here are the most affordable Foothill Green apartments for rent in Denver, CO:

Best Value Apartments for Rent in Foothill Green, CO

As of May 28, 2025 the best value apartment in the Foothill Green area is the $2.27 price per square foot B20B Model at Vista at Trappers Glen in the in the Weaver Creek neighborhood starting from $2,224. The second greatest value Foothill Green apartment is the Sonoma Model at Columbine Meadows Townhomes starting at $1,800 with a $1.88 price per square foot in the Vintage Reserve neighborhood.
